New Additions to the Board of Directors
| Larry Winter (left) and Thomas Jorling (right) are the newest members of the NEON, Inc. Board of Directors. Larry Winter, Deputy Director of the National Center for Atmospheric Research, was previously Chairman of the NEON Advisory Board. Thomas Jorling, VP for Environmental Affairs at International Paper (ret.), served as a member of the NEON Consortium Development Committee. Board Chairman James A. MacMahon welcomed the new members at the June 13-14, 2006 Board meeting in Washington, DC. [Meet the Board] | ![]() |

NEON on Capitol Hill

NSF Director Arden Bement (left) discusses educational outreach with ecologist and NEON representative Margaret Lowman at the Coalition for National Science Funding event held at the Rayburn House Office Building in Washington, DC, June 7, 2006. Dr. Lowman, a pioneer in forest canopy ecology and ESA VP-elect for Education and Human Resources, served on the NEON Design Consortium as a member of the Informal Education Subcommittee. "Dr. Bement made an impassioned commentary to me about how we know more about Mars than we do about the ecosystems of the Earth," said Lowman. "He also noted the importance of the Observatory's educational outreach component, including the use of NEON data for K-12 science education activities."
